Terminating a security contract, including your Alaska Alarm System Sale, Installation and Monitoring Service Agreement, requires a clear understanding of the cancellation terms in your agreement. Begin by notifying your service provider in writing about your intention to cancel. Ensure you follow any specified procedures to avoid additional charges or complications.

If you wish to cancel your ADT contract without incurring penalties, review your Alaska Alarm System Sale, Installation and Monitoring Service Agreement for any stipulations. Generally, you can cancel within a specific period after signing, usually around three days. Additionally, some states have laws ensuring your right to cancel under certain conditions, so it's wise to familiarize yourself with those guidelines or seek assistance from a legal expert.
